Then, start the OpenNebula services:

sudo systemctl start opennebula
sudo systemctl start opennebula-sunstone

Access the Sunstone web UI from your Windows 10 host browser:
https://<sandbox-ip>:9869 – default credentials: oneadmin / opennebula.

This report details the acquisition, verification, and deployment of the OpenNebula Sandbox version 5.0 OVA file for use on Windows 10. OpenNebula is an open-source platform for building cloud computing infrastructures. The "Sandbox" is a pre-configured virtual appliance designed to allow users to test and experiment with OpenNebula without a complex installation process.

Important Note: OpenNebula 5.0 (released in 2016) is an End-of-Life (EOL) version. While the specific request is for version 5.0, this report strongly advises using a newer, supported version (such as 6.x) for security and stability. However, instructions for locating the legacy 5.0 version are provided below.
